emptii : Can you explain a little more detail on "single targeting"? Also what is Limit Break farming? What do Limit Breaks use for? When you attack with a unit, the limit bar of this unit fills a little, and when it is completely full, if you have "Auto" activated, the unit runs the "Skill limit". Therefore, the more times a unit attacks, more time will fill the "bar limit" and, consequently, more time will realize the "Skill Limit" with a unit. What purpose does this? The level of "Skill limit" of each unit increases as you go running it. So the more times you run the "Skill limit", more levels will go up. What emptii propose is to set the script in battles, your whole team to attack a single enemy for each turn (now by selecting Auto, your team automatically attacks all possible enemies in one turn). Clicking on an enemy remains as selected and attacks are directed only against that enemy, so only kill an enemy every turn, making more attacks to kill all the enemies in the dungeon, which means running more times "Skill limit", increasing its levels. Also what is Limit Break farming? What do Limit Breaks use for? Sorry for late reply. About limit burst farming idea: My response will contain 2 parts: explanation and suggestion. If you already got the idea just skip to the second part PART 1: ExplanationLimit Bursts can be leveled up by multiple uses. The problem is it takes THOUSANDS of uses, sounds like TM Farming, eh? You will need to fill the LB Gauge by hitting the enemies and you will randomly gain limit burst crystals ( ). Units will need to get 8 - 12 crystals in a dungeon until they can use limit bursts. TM Farming at the Earth shrine exit will sometimes get some of your units to use their limit burst but because the limit burst crystals are randomly dropped, sometimes your units' gauges don't fill up by the time the battle ends. PART 2: SuggestionThe easiest way to maximize the number of LB Crystal is to select single target (tapping on a monster unit) before going AUTO, but I believe doing that in every battle is going to be a bit tricky. Plus, from my experience, doing so in the first battle only is enough to make sure all of your units can fill their limit burst gauge. So, here's what I think will work - 1. (Continue from your script) Enter the dungeon.
2. At battle one, single tap a monster unit like this: (the monsters always appear in the same position. See the red V above the bat)
Image: postimg.org/image/qm3jp8dzf/
3. Press AUTO (Continue with your current script)
I've been using this method manually before coming across your great script and all units get to use their limit bursts most of the time. If you need any more detail please let me know.
